India, Dec. 15 -- Noida A 21-year-old man was arrested in Noida on Sunday for allegedly duping people in Delhi-National Capital Region by promising a Rs.7,000 monthly remuneration on investing Rs.85,000 in an e-scooter scheme, police said, adding that he along with his accomplice cheated nearly 30 people in the last two months.

The fraud came to light after two Noida Phase 2 residents filed a police complaint, said Vindyachal Tiwari, station house officer (SHO) (Phase 2).

Police identified the arrested suspect as Saurabh Mishra, a matriculate, originally from Darbhanga, Bihar, residing in Banghel area of Phase 2, and his accomplice as Gaurav Mishra, a computer science graduate, who is yet to be apprehended. Gaurav is already out on bail...
